As planilhas que você salvou no software Microsoft Excel pode ser modificado usando o Visual Basic for Applications (VBA) linguagem de programação. Você pode usar o código VBA para alterar o conteúdo das células ou até mesmo pedir um usuário para a entrada específica. Se você quiser adicionar uma camada extra de controle para o seu código , você pode utilizar as declarações de lógica que lhe permitem tomar ações diferentes com base em situações pré-determinadas. Existem várias declarações lógicas diferentes disponíveis para serem usados no Excel VBA. Instruções
If /Then /Else
1
Abra sua planilha do Excel e clique na guia "Desenvolvedor" . Clique no ícone " Visual Basic" e , em seguida, selecione a planilha específica onde você quer adicionar instruções lógicas.
2
Entre na abertura e fechamento de "Sub" comandos se eles já não estão presentes em seu VBA código . Por exemplo, se você quer para nomear a nova seção do código " UsingLogic , " tipo " Sub UsingLogic ()" e , em seguida, mover para baixo algumas linhas e digite " End Sub ".
3
Vá para qualquer linha entre o fechamento de comando "Sub" e abertura . Use o comando " Se " para adicionar uma camada de lógica ao seu código . Por exemplo, se você tem um número inteiro chamado " imposto " e que pretende executar um código com base em seu valor, tipo "se imposto < 100".
4
Adicionar em uma declaração: " Então," a executar um código quando seu " Se a ' afirmação é verdadeira . Por exemplo digite" Se Imposto < 100 Então Cells ( 1, 1) . valor = 100 " para mudar a primeira célula com o valor de " 100 " se o inteiro fiscal é atualmente menos de 100.
5
Adicionar em uma instrução " Else" para levar em conta o que o código deve fazer se o original "If" afirmação não é verdadeira . Por exemplo digite " Se Imposto < 100 Então Cells (1, 1). value = 100 células mais ( 1,1) . valor = 50 ", se você quiser que o valor da célula para mudar para 50, se o valor do inteiro imposto atualmente é maior que 100.
para
/Next Statement
6
Acesse a guia "Desenvolvedor" e selecione " Visual Basic ". Navegue até a seção do código onde você deseja adicionar o For /Próxima comunicado.
7
Declare o intervalo que deseja usar para a instrução. por exemplo digite " para a = 1 a 5 " se você quer a declaração para ser executado através de cinco iterações.
8
Mover para baixo uma linha e digite " Cells (a, 1) = a". Mover para baixo uma outra linha e tipo "Next um " se você deseja executar durante os primeiros cinco células em sua pasta de trabalho e digite um número cada vez maior em cada célula.
Declaração Select Case
9
Vá para a aba "Developer" na sua pasta de trabalho Excel e escolha a opção " Visual Basic ". Clique na área no código onde você quer adicionar uma instrução " Select Case " .
10
Definir uma variável que você deseja usar para selecionar as condições da declaração . por exemplo, digite "Usuários Dim as Integer " se você quiser definir um inteiro chamado "Usuários ".
11
Mover para baixo uma linha e digite "Usuários Select Case " . Mover para baixo uma outra linha e entra nas condições de usar para o caso, por exemplo "Usuários Is> = 10 ", se você quiser executar algum código , se o valor de "Usuários" é atualmente maior ou igual a 10.
12
Desça outra linha e entrar no código a ser executado se "Usuários" é menor ou igual a 10 , como " Cells (1,1 ) . Valor = 50 " . Mover para baixo uma outra linha e entrar em tantos outros casos, como você quer usar , como " usuários é < 5 " se você quiser executar o código se o " Usuários " variável é actualmente inferior a 5 .
13
Mover para baixo uma linha e digite" End Select "para acabar com o comunicado.